Hinweis
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, sich anzumelden oder das Verzeichnis zu wechseln.
Für den Zugriff auf diese Seite ist eine Autorisierung erforderlich. Sie können versuchen, das Verzeichnis zu wechseln.
Anheften von Zuständen einer Platzhalterdatei oder eines Verzeichnisses.
Syntax
typedef enum CF_PIN_STATE {
CF_PIN_STATE_UNSPECIFIED = 0,
CF_PIN_STATE_PINNED = 1,
CF_PIN_STATE_UNPINNED = 2,
CF_PIN_STATE_EXCLUDED = 3,
CF_PIN_STATE_INHERIT = 4
} ;
Konstanten
CF_PIN_STATE_UNSPECIFIEDWert: 0 Die Plattform kann frei entscheiden, wann der Inhalt des Platzhalters lokal auf dem Datenträger vorhanden sein muss oder fehlt. |
CF_PIN_STATE_PINNEDWert: 1 Der Synchronisierungsanbieter wird benachrichtigt, den Inhalt des Platzhalters asynchron abzurufen, nachdem die Pinanforderung von der Plattform empfangen wurde. Es gibt keine Garantie, dass die zu anheftenden Platzhalter lokal vollständig verfügbar sind, nachdem ein CfSetPinState-Aufruf erfolgreich abgeschlossen wurde. Die Plattform schlägt jedoch jede Dehydrierungsanforderung für angeheftete Platzhalter fehl. |
CF_PIN_STATE_UNPINNEDWert: 2 Der Synchronisierungsanbieter wird benachrichtigt, um den Inhalt des Platzhalters auf dem Datenträger asynchron zu dehydrieren/ungültig zu machen, nachdem die Unpin-Anforderung von der Plattform empfangen wurde. Es gibt keine Garantie dafür, dass die zu entheftenden Platzhalter vollständig dehydriert werden, nachdem der API-Aufruf erfolgreich abgeschlossen wurde. |
CF_PIN_STATE_EXCLUDEDWert: 3 der Platzhalter wird vom Synchronisierungsanbieter nie mit der Cloud synchronisiert. Dieser Zustand kann nur vom Synchronisierungsanbieter festgelegt werden. |
CF_PIN_STATE_INHERITWert: 4 Die Plattform behandelt es so, als ob der Aufrufer einen Bewegungsvorgang für den Platzhalter ausführt und daher den Pinstatus des Platzhalters basierend auf dem Pinstatus des übergeordneten Elements neu auswertet. Eine Vererbungstabelle finden Sie im Abschnitt Hinweise . |
Hinweise
| Parent | Nicht angegeben. | Pinned | Nicht angeheftet | Ausgeschlossen | |
|---|---|---|---|---|---|
| Datei | Nicht angegeben. | Nicht angegeben. | Pinned | Nicht angegeben. | Ausgeschlossen |
| Pinned | Pinned | Pinned | Pinned | Ausgeschlossen | |
| Nicht angeheftet | Nicht angeheftet | Nicht angeheftet | Nicht angeheftet | Ausgeschlossen | |
| Ausgeschlossen | Nicht angegeben. | Pinned | Nicht angegeben. | Ausgeschlossen | |
| Verzeichnis | Nicht angegeben. | Nicht angegeben. | Pinned | Nicht angeheftet | Ausgeschlossen |
| Pinned | Pinned | Pinned | Pinned | Ausgeschlossen | |
| Nicht angeheftet | Nicht angeheftet | Nicht angeheftet | Nicht angeheftet | Ausgeschlossen | |
| Ausgeschlossen | Nicht angegeben. | Pinned | Nicht angeheftet | Ausgeschlossen |
Anforderungen
| Anforderung | Wert |
|---|---|
| Unterstützte Mindestversion (Client) | Windows 10, Version 1709 [nur Desktop-Apps] |
| Unterstützte Mindestversion (Server) | Windows Server 2016 [nur Desktop-Apps] |
| Kopfzeile | cfapi.h |